Members Only – Trustee posts available!

Dear Q:alliance Member,

Our AGM is coming up on the 3rd of June 2011, and we would like to invite you to consider becoming a member of our management team. This is more commonly known as a ‘trustee’ position.

In addition to the seven trustees who will be seeking re-election at the AGM, there is room for at least one more Ordinary Member to join the management team.

The team meets on average once a month, but meetings may be more frequent if, for example, Q:alliance was developing a new project.

If you want to become more involved in the actions of Q:alliance through joining the team, please submit a short biography of your experience and knowledge of such a management to David Ennis (that’s me). E-mail it to: communications {at} qalliance.org(.)uk

The deadline for submissions will be 1pm on Thursday the 2nd of June 2011.

In terms of what would benefit us most at the present time, it would be good for us to have a Lesbian representative on the management team. If you have a desire to develop Lesbian interests in Milton Keynes, please do put your name forward.

If you would like more information about trustee positions before you submit an entry, please feel free to e-mail me.
